Applying Ethics and Professional Judgment in Nursing Practice Ethical practice lies at the heart of the nursing profession. Nurses often face complex situations that require moral reasoning, compassion, and adherence to professional standards. NURS FPX 4055 Assessment 2 focuses on developing students’ ability to navigate ethical dilemmas while maintaining accountability and professionalism. In this assessment, learners engage in critical analysis of ethical principles, such as autonomy, beneficence, justice, and nonmaleficence. They apply these principles to real-world cases that test their decision-making and moral judgment. For example, they may evaluate situations involving end-of-life care, patient confidentiality, or allocation of limited resources—each requiring careful consideration of both ethical and practical implications. The assessment also introduces students to the American Nurses Association (ANA) Code of Ethics, a framework that guides professional conduct. By understanding these ethical guidelines, students learn how to balance their personal values with professional responsibilities. They also gain confidence in making decisions that respect patient rights and promote equitable care. Another key component of this stage is the integration of evidence-based practice (EBP). Ethical decision-making in modern healthcare must be informed by current research and best practices. Students are encouraged to use scientific evidence to support their clinical reasoning and ensure that their ethical choices align with quality standards. By completing this assessment, learners enhance their ability to address ethical challenges with clarity, compassion, and confidence. They also strengthen their commitment to the principles of honesty, respect, and patient-centered care—values that form the foundation of professional nursing. Cultivating Leadership and Reflective Practice Leadership is an essential competency for all nurses, regardless of their position. It involves influencing others, promoting collaboration, and ensuring that patient care remains safe, efficient, and compassionate. NURS FPX 4055 Assessment 3 focuses on the development of leadership skills through reflection, evidence-based analysis, and practical application. In this stage, students learn how to apply leadership theories—such as transformational, servant, and democratic leadership—to nursing practice. These models emphasize communication, empowerment, and vision, helping nurses guide their teams toward shared goals. Students analyze how leadership directly affects staff morale, workflow efficiency, and patient outcomes. The assessment also challenges learners to reflect on their leadership potential. By evaluating their strengths and areas for improvement, they gain insights into how they can contribute more effectively to healthcare organizations. Reflection helps nursing students identify personal values, refine communication styles, and develop resilience—all essential traits of effective leaders. Another key aspect of this assessment is the focus on quality improvement. Students are encouraged to identify a problem within a healthcare setting, analyze its root causes, and propose data-driven solutions. Through this process, they learn how leadership and evidence-based strategies intersect to enhance patient safety and organizational performance. Furthermore, this stage highlights the importance of advocacy. Nurses are not only caregivers but also change agents who influence policies, promote equity, and advance patient welfare. By cultivating leadership skills, learners prepare to take on roles that extend beyond bedside care—roles that involve shaping the future of healthcare through innovation and policy reform.
